Literature summary for 2.4.1.15 extracted from

  • Lapp, D.; Patterson, B.W.; Elbein, A.D.
    Properties of a trehalose phosphate synthetase from Mycobacterium smegmatis (1971), J. Biol. Chem., 246, 4567-4579.

additional information when pyrimidine sugar nucleotides are used as substrates, there is an almost absolute requirement for a high molecular weight polyanion for activity. When the purine sugar nucleotides are used as substrates fairly good enzymatic activity is observed in absence of a polyanion, this activity increases 2 to 4fold in the presence of optimum concentrations of polyanion. Activation by the polyanion is inhibited by high salt concentrations as well as by high concentrations of mononucleoside phosphates Mycolicibacterium smegmatis
